Landscape Design Sketch Drawing

"Landscape design sketch drawing refers to the visual representation of landscape design ideas through hand-drawn sketches. It is an essential tool for designers to communicate their concepts and visions to clients and stakeholders. These sketches often include elements such as trees, buildings, pathways, and water features, depicted in a simplified and stylized manner to convey the overall layout and mood of the proposed design."...
